Linux开启Oracle一步一步实现(linux启oracle)

Linux开启Oracle:一步一步实现

Oracle数据库是世界上最著名的关系型数据库之一。许多公司和组织都使用Oracle作为他们的核心数据库管理系统。本文将提供一个详细的步骤来启用Oracle数据库在Linux系统上的实现。我们将通过以下步骤来安装和配置Oracle:

一、安装Oracle数据库软件

在开始安装Oracle之前,确保你的Linux系统已经安装了所有必需的软件包。这些软件包可以通过Linux系统的软件包管理器安装。在软件包管理器中,你只需要搜索”Oracle”,然后从结果列表中选择Oracle数据库安装软件即可。

在安装Oracle数据库软件之前,需要一些先决条件,这些先决条件是:

– 操作系统的硬件要求。Oracle Database要求至少要128 MB的RAM,最少需要1 GB可用磁盘空间;

– 配置网络设置,必须拥有一个适当的域名服务器(DNS)解析正常,应为静态IP;

– 配置操作系统内核参数以满足Oracle数据库的要求;

在满足上述先决条件之后,请从Oracle官网下载Oracle数据库软件。

在下载完Oracle数据库软件安装包之后,我们可以使用以下命令来解压Oracle安装文件:

# unzip oracle_db111.zip -d /u01/software

解压后,你应该可以在”/u01/software/database”目录下找到安装器的目录和文件。

在完成解压工作之后,我们将会在”/u01/software/database/stage”目录下找到两个文件:

1. Oracle Database软件(oracle.rsp)响应文件

2. Oracle Database安装程序(runInstaller)

二、运行Oracle安装程序

第一步,我们需要在Linux系统上创建一个Oracle用户,以便在这个用户下运行Oracle数据库。我们可以使用以下命令来创建这个用户:

# groupadd oinstall

# groupadd dba

# useradd -g oinstall -G dba oracle

# passwd oracle

第二步,我们需要编辑”.bash_profile”文件,设置ORACLE_HOME、ORACLE_SID、PATH等Oracle的环境变量:

# Oracle Settings

export TMP=/tmp

export TMPDIR=$TMP

# ORACLE ENV VARIABLES

export ORACLE_BASE=/u01/app/oracle

export ORACLE_HOME=$ORACLE_BASE/product/11.2.0/dbhome_1

export ORACLE_SID=orcl

export PATH=$ORACLE_HOME/bin:$PATH

suffix=”.so”

if [ `uname -m | grep 64 | wc -l` = 1 ]

then

suffix=”_64${suffix}”

fi

export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$ORACLE_HOME/lib/stubs:$LD_LIBRARY_PATH:/lib:/usr/lib:/usr/local/lib:${ORACLE_HOME}/oracle/lib:${ORACLE_HOME}/lib32:${ORACLE_HOME}/lib32://usr/lib32:/usr/lib64:/usr/local/lib64:${ORACLE_HOME}/oracle/lib:${ORACLE_HOME}/lib32:${ORACLE_HOME}/lib32:/usr/lib64/libc++/${suffix};

export CLASSPATH=$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ib

第三步,我们需要启动X窗口系统,否则无法继续Oracle数据库的配置和安装。在控制台上键入以下命令:

$ xhost +localhost

第四步,查看准备工作是否完成,使用以下命令:

# cd /u01/software/database/stage

#./runInstaller -silent -responseFile oracle.rsp

三、配置和启动Oracle数据库

在完成Oracle的安装和配置之后,我们需要启动Oracle数据库并进行必要的配置。我们可以使用以下命令来启动Oracle数据库:

# su – oracle

# sqlplus /nolog

SQL> conn /as sysdba

SQL> startup

/* 创建新的表空间 */

SQL> create tablespace test datafile ‘/u01/app/oracle/oradata/orcl/test.dbf’ size 100m autoextend on next 10m maxsize unlimited;

到这里我们已经成功启用Oracle数据库,现在可以将其用于任何需要使用Oracle的项目中。


数据运维技术 » Linux开启Oracle一步一步实现(linux启oracle)